Chains
Drive components with extensive properties designed to transfer power between shafts.
Chain geometries will differ according to their main function (load or transmission) and so will the type of link and pin and their
distribution and number.
RECOMMENDATIONS
The choice of lubricant will depend on the type of chain, its speed, operating temperature, load and environmental influence,
deciding on the lubricant which best penetrates the casing to lubricate the rollers. We recommend a lubricant with the best possible
anti-wear, anti-corrosion and sealing characteristics, not forgetting compatibility with sealing materials.
OIL LUBRICATION: Choice of viscosity
The table below serves as a guideline to choose the correct viscosity of the oil to be used for the lubrication of the chain in
accordance with its linear speed, the greasing system used (manual, drip, splash or forced circulation), and the pressure the pin is
subjected to.

The viscosity values illustrated in the table above for the selection of the ideal oil for the lubrication of chains are standard values for operating temperatures of -20º C to +50º C. For
temperatures beyond this range or extraordinary environmental conditions please contact our technical support service. OLIPES provides tailor-made solutions to meet your needs.
Although the use of oils with different degrees of viscosity is recommended for the lubrication of chains, the use of specific greases may also be recommended in certain cases.
